From nakano.hiroaki @ nttcom.co.jp Wed Aug 1 16:01:36 2012 From: nakano.hiroaki @ nttcom.co.jp (=?ISO-2022-JP?B?GyRCQ2ZMbiEhOShPLxsoQg==?=) Date: Wed, 01 Aug 2012 16:01:36 +0900 Subject: [Ultramonkey-l7-develop 803] =?iso-2022-jp?b?VWx0cmFNb25rZXktTDcgdjMuMC40LXJjMRskQjh4MysbKEI=?= Message-ID: <5018D450.8080602@nttcom.co.jp> 中野@CWです。 UltraMonkey-L7 v3.0.4のRC1版を以下で公開します。 http://ultramonkey-l7.sourceforge.jp/_tmp/tmp_uml7_3_0_4 (バイナリはとりあえずx86_64版のみの用意です。) 上記パッケージに対応するソースツリーは、v3.0.4-develブランチに なります。 特に重大な不具合が見つからなければ、来週中に v3.0.4版を正式リリースするつもりです。 v3.0.3からの変更点は以下の通りです。 ================================ CHANGES | 690 ----------- l7directord/l7directord | 33 l7vsd/include/tcp_data.h | 40 l7vsd/include/tcp_realserver_connect_socket_list.h | 74 - l7vsd/include/tcp_session.h | 3 l7vsd/include/tcp_socket.h | 6 l7vsd/include/tcp_ssl_socket.h | 6 l7vsd/include/virtualservice.h | 331 ----- l7vsd/src/tcp_realserver_connect_socket_list.cpp | 77 - l7vsd/src/tcp_session.cpp | 84 + l7vsd/src/tcp_socket.cpp | 300 ----- l7vsd/src/tcp_ssl_socket.cpp | 263 ---- l7vsd/src/virtualservice_base.cpp | 1 l7vsd/src/virtualservice_tcp.cpp | 1258 ++++++++++----------- 14 files changed, 747 insertions(+), 2419 deletions(-) ○修正内容リスト ・チケット #27216 の修正 リアルサーバ全ダウン時に接続すると無応答状態となる ・チケット #27223 の修正 SorryFlagをONにすると稀にSEGVする ・チケット #29127 の修正 新規モジュールを開発すると、l7directordのモジュール名チェックで はじかれてしまう問題。 ・チケット #29128 の修正 サービス監視に失敗したときは、ポート監視に移行していたのを サービス監視をリトライするようにする。 ・チケット #29142 の修正 リアルサーバ切り離し時クラッシュ対処 ・チケット #29147 の修正 mutex.lock -> mutex.unlock ・チケット #29143 の修正 SSLハンドシェイクエラー対処 ・チケット #29144 の修正 SSL clear_socketエラー対処 ・チケット #29150 の修正 socket cancelの挿入 ・コードのクリーンアップ ================================ -- 中野 宏朗 (NAKANO Hiroaki)